Читаем Приключения инженера полностью

И тогда мы изобрели противоядие. Зачем, рассуждали мы, сваливать в общую кучу все вычисления? Не лучше ли разделить их по функциям разных систем и каждой информационной системе подарить по небольшому вычислителю. И хотя общее быстродействие станет еще больше, так же как и память, но каждый вычислитель будет небольшим, он приобретет хозяина — разработчика соответствующей информационной системы, тот будет заботиться о своей части задачи, на выходе у него будут стандартные выходные параметры, а тогда каждый системщик сможет у себя внутри вытворять, что его душе угодно, это никак не скажется на общем комплексировании.

Мало того, если выходные параметры каждой системы стандартизировать, то в одном комплексе можно собирать и старые, и новые системы, и на любом этапе, если новые системы не успевают, поставить пока старые, а потом, когда новые системы будут готовы, поставить их. Простенько, но со вкусом. Тем более, что малые вычислители делать проще, чем большие.

Это направление полностью себя оправдало, и с тех пор комплексы так и строятся, причем самих встроенных вычислителей на борту развелось невероятно много: на каждом самолете их стало больше сотни. Но теперь это никого уже не пугает. А аппетиты программистов все равно продолжают расти, зато не так быстро.

Но вскоре оказалось, что вариантов встроенных вычислителей появилось слишком много, а это дорого. И значит, надо, во-первых, узаконить связи между вычислителями, во-вторых, навести порядок во внутреннем обмене информацией, в-третьих, узаконить какую-то общую систему команд для всех вычислителей, а в-четвертых, вообще навести порядок в функциональной математике.

Первые три проблемы, так или иначе, касались «железа». Один из руководителей приборного Главка Юрий Семенович помог собрать совещание, на котором эти три проблемы были решены ко всеобщему удовольствию. Это был тот редчайший случай, когда министерский работник принес реальную пользу. Лично у Юрия Семеновича это тоже был особый случай. Но что касается «в-четвертых», то тут машина встала.

Когда-то я насчитал в нашей промышленности 15 групп математиков, работающих независимо друг от друга в области навигационных алгоритмов, причем только на одном из ленинградских предприятий их одновременно было пять. Мне это показалось странным. Зачем, подумал я, их так много? Ведь земной шар у нас один, атмосфера тоже. Все мы пользуемся географическими координатами, состав оборудования на всех самолетах практически один и тот же. Ну, добавили корректирующие средства, ну, не добавили. Суть-то от этого не меняется. А тут 15 групп! Ведь наверняка они нагородят каждая свое, потом концов не соберешь. И я попросил все ту же Надежду Ивановну взять из разных эскизных проектов формульные зависимости какой-нибудь небольшой задачи, например, доплеровское счисление координат и написать их рядом для сравнения. Надежда Ивановна выписала формулы одной и той же задачи из разных проектов, всего таких проектов под рукой оказалось семь. И выяснилось, что сравнивать эти формулы нельзя, так как все они записаны в разных обозначениях. Я порекомендовал ей взять какую-нибудь одну систему обозначений, любую, какая ей больше понравится, и переписать все формулы в одной системе. И тут выяснилось, что все эти формулы отличаются друг от друга выражением для радиуса Земли: у одних этот радиус принят за постоянную величину, у других к нему добавлена первая геометрическая гармоника, потому что он все-таки не совсем постоянный, у третьих — еще и вторая гармоника, у четвертых этот радиус остался в знаменателе, как и был, но гармоники переведены в числитель, и так далее. И хотя все формулы были похожи друг на друга, как близнецы-братья, все же они были разными, алгоритмы под них получались разными, программы разными, а уж с учетом разнообразия систем команд в вычислителях все это было абсолютно несовместимо. Отсюда и 15 групп навигаторов.

А сколько их сейчас — никто не знает, потому что в математике так никто и не навел порядка, хотя такие попытки предпринимались. А тут еще и «Перестройка».

Как-то так получалось, что мне никак не удавалось создать в своей лаборатории математическую группу. Стоило только собрать у себя несколько математиков, как их тут же забирали в другие лаборатории, или они уходили сами в другие места.

Конечно, это объяснялось, прежде всего, тем, что по функциональным обязанностям наша лаборатория не должна была заниматься математикой. Наше дело — инструментовка, а вовсе не математика. А наведением порядка в математике должны были заниматься другие лаборатории, которым это поручено, но которые как раз этим и не занимались. Потому что, зачем? И тогда я пошел на хитрость.

Перейти на страницу:

Похожие книги

100 способов уложить ребенка спать
100 способов уложить ребенка спать

Благодаря этой книге французские мамы и папы блестяще справляются с проблемой, которая волнует родителей во всем мире, – как без труда уложить ребенка 0–4 лет спать. В книге содержатся 100 простых и действенных советов, как раз и навсегда забыть о вечерних капризах, нежелании засыпать, ночных побудках, неспокойном сне, детских кошмарах и многом другом. Всемирно известный психолог, одна из основоположников французской системы воспитания Анн Бакюс считает, что проблемы гораздо проще предотвратить, чем сражаться с ними потом. Достаточно лишь с младенчества прививать малышу нужные привычки и внимательно относиться к тому, как по мере роста меняется характер его сна.

Анн Бакюс

Зарубежная образовательная литература, зарубежная прикладная, научно-популярная литература / Детская психология / Образование и наука
Пираты. Рассказы о знаменитых разбойниках
Пираты. Рассказы о знаменитых разбойниках

Эта увлекательная книга, посвященная истории морского пиратства, уникальна широтой охвата темы: в ней рассказано о датских, норманнских, испанских, вест-индских, малайских, алжирских и многих других жестоких и беспощадных морских разбойниках, наводивших страх на моряков и мирный торговый люд в разных районах Мирового океана. Повествования о жизни флибустьеров, дополненные материалами судебных процессов, отчетами адмиралтейства, рассказами несчастных, попавших в руки пиратов, о страданиях и злоключениях, которые им пришлось пережить, позволят узнать много интересного всем, кто интересуется захватывающими историями о людях, плававших под черным флагом много лет назад.

Чарльз Элмс

Зарубежная образовательная литература, зарубежная прикладная, научно-популярная литература